Publisher's Synopsis

From author James Cloud comes the classic and powerful epic adventure that captures the gorgeous intensity of life in Germany during the early 20th century. It is the extraordinary saga of people who lived there during exciting and dangerous times. It is a tale of love and danger, of unthinkable loss - a stunning and vivid portrayal of people divided by class, faith, and prejudice - an expert, sensational story that unveils the face of a fascinating, majestic city of dazzling elegance and decadence. Berlin is the stage on which the drama of history is played in a portrayal of strident patriotism, wrenching sorrow, exuberant optimism, dashed hopes, terror and ultimate descent into one of history's darkest periods. The author, James Cloud is a retired educator with more than 40 years of experience teaching History, Government, German, and English as a Second Language. Among his awards are The Adult Educator of the Year in Utah. The author attended the Institute of Arts in West Berlin and worked as an interpreter for the British Military Mission during the Cold War years. While living in Germany, he developed an intimate knowledge of both East and West Berlin. Cloud later completed a Master's Degree in German Linguistics and Literature at California State University at Fullerton. Brandenburg: A Story of Berlin received the Five Stars award in 2019 by Reader's Favorites, and is also an award winner in the 2019 Reader's Favorite award contest for the category Fiction - Cultural.
